> OK so it works with my ALS007 with the diff I include below,
> except that the 16 bit dma is set to 0 (there is no such dma on ALS007)
> But for now it's harmless...
>
> Also there will be a problem with mpu401 because at least the ALS007
> has a separate irq for that.
